Newtown median home prices fell by 27.4% in July 2021

The median sale price of a home sold in July 2021 in Newtown fell by $62,000 while total sales increased by 33.3%, according to BlockShopper.com.

In July 2021, there were eight homes sold, with a median sale price of $164,500 - a 27.4% decrease over the $226,500 median sale price for the same period of the previous year. There were six homes sold in Newtown in July 2020.
